What does local knowledge integration emphasize in participatory planning?

ARelying solely on professional experts for planning decisions

BThe inclusion of lived experiences, cultural practices, and indigenous knowledge of the community

CExcluding traditional practices in favor of modern techniques

DDisregarding the community's historical methods for resource management

Answer:

B. The inclusion of lived experiences, cultural practices, and indigenous knowledge of the community

Read Explanation:

Local knowledge integration emphasizes the inclusion of lived experiences, cultural practices, and indigenous knowledge of the community in the planning process. This ensures that the planning reflects the community's realities and that important traditional insights are not overlooked.
